LFF: Up in the Air First Look

Sunday, October 18, 2009 5:01AM - By

upintheairkj09 09 08 LFF: Up in the Air First Look

Just walked out of an LFF screening for Up in the Air and had the feeling of “finally.” The film stars George Clooney, Vera Farmiga, Anna Kendrick, and Jason Bateman, in a story about a guy who travels around the US firing people and becoming a master traveler.

Overall the film used ideas that we had seen before, but in a new and fresh way. There was the guy that travels and refuses to settle down, a young plucky employee shoving out the “old guy”, and a problem that must be solved. The ending you could see a mile away, but the feelings that came with it was not what you would expect. In a way Jason Reitman the director/writer found a new way to use cliches, making them a new form of non-cliche-cliches. To top that off, he finally gives a good reason for a man running through at airport to get to a woman, so for that I thank him.

Teaser Clip from Jason Reitman’s Up in the Air

Tuesday, September 8, 2009 2:59PM - By

upintheairkj09 09 08 Teaser Clip from Jason Reitmans Up in the Air

The latest film by Juno director Jason Reitman, Up in the Air, has been creating buzz as serious competitor for an Oscar, (although at the moment The Hurt Locker seems to be the other film which is Oscar worthy). The movie is about a Ryan Bingham, George Clooney, a man who travels around helping corporations with downsizing. While on a job, he meets another seasoned traveler, Alex (Vera Farmiga) in a hotel bar.

In the clip, Clooney’s characters meets Farmiga’s for the first time. They bond over being road warriors, comparing each others credit cards and the mileage plans. Of course there is a little friendly banter, flirting, and George Clooney being his normal charming self.

Orphan Trailer: Yet Another Freaky Child

Friday, March 13, 2009 2:00PM - By

orphan09 3 13 Orphan Trailer: Yet Another Freaky Child

What is it about children that scares us so much? From the little girls playing jump rope singing “one two, Freddy’s coming for you,” to adorable killer vampire children in Let the Right One In horror films love scary, possessed, killers children. Think about it. Horror films have one of two things: Boobs or scary children. If there isn’t some stupid blond running around half naked covered in blond there is a child trying to kill you in some way. You have Danny from The Shining yelling “REDRUM,” the attack of the killer blond children in The Village of the Damned and the freaky devil child from Unborn; scary movies love having freaky children.

Orphan is about a husband (Peter Sarsgaar) and wife (Vera Farmiga) who recently lost their baby adopt a 9-year-old girl (Isabelle Fuhrman) named Esther. Not long after they bring her home, odd things begin to happens and they think that there’s something wrong with Esther and pretty soon things begin to spiral out of control and be learn Esther may not be as innocent as she seems.
